Karl RoveKarl Rove forecast 338 for ObamaNow all the US states bar Missouri have been called, the electoral votes vote tally is 364 to Obama and 173 to McCain. McCain is currently expected to take Missouri which would make Obama’s final tally 364 electoral college votes. (Check the New York Times’ excellent election map).

Using this electoral vote tally we can do a quick analysis of how accurate the various pollsters and prediction markets have been. The 3 Blue Dudes site has been tracking 84 different pollsters, pundits and prediction markets for the past few months. On the day before election day they took a snapshot of the current forecasts. 3 Blue Dudes recorded Hubdub as projecting exactly 364 electoral college votes for Obama!

The markets behind the Hubdub election map all closed prior to the polls closing. As you can see the 11 undecided moved into the McCain camp prior to the close.

How did the pollsters and pundits compare? Not so good. Only 7 of the 81 other pollsters and pundits predicted Obama winning 364 electoral votes.

Some of the major media sites, pollsters and pundits that didn’t do so well were:

New York Times: 291 to Obama (84 undecided)

CNN: 291 to Obama (90 undecided)

Washington Post: 319 to Obama

Zogby: 311 to Obama (51 undecided)

Karl Rove: 338 to Obama

All in all, a great night for Obama and a great night for Hubdub’s forecasts.
